[android-developers] Developer fee payment canceled after 2.5 years

Hi!

I'm struggling with this problem since yesterday, when I tried to log
into my Google Play Console just to find a message like this:

---
THE PAYMENT FOR THE REGISTRATION FEE HAS FAILED
In order to access your account, you need a successful registration fee payment
---

So my apps are still published, but I can't manage any of them. No
price changes, no descripcion updates and, of course, no new .apk...

Since I've been a registered Android developer circa July 2010, I
wonder what the heck happened. After checking my Checkout order I
found that it was "canceled because it has been inactive for a long
period of time"

"10 Ene - Google ha cancelado su pedido porque ha estado inactivo
durante un largo período de tiempo."

This seems like a known issues(Developer Console or Publishing
Issues/Unable to complete Google Play Android Developer Account
Registration ), but as the description of the issue appears to refer
to new accounts, I think it doesn't apply to me:

https://support.google.com/googleplay/android-developer/bin/static.py?hl=en&page=known_issues.cs

I've already sent a support ticket, but you all know how long will this take...

Searching on Google, forums or mail lists I couldn't find anyone with
the same problem, so I decided to try and post it here in case anyone
is having the same issue.
